#658030 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#658030 is composed of 39.6% red, 50.2% green and 18.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 21.1% cyan, 0% magenta, 62.5% yellow and 49.8% black. It has a hue angle of 80.3 degrees, a saturation of 45.5% and a lightness of 34.5%. #658030 color hex could be obtained by blending #caff60 with #000100. Closest websafe color is: #669933.

#658030 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#658030 has RGB values of R:101, G:128, B:48 and CMYK values of C:0.21, M:0, Y:0.63, K:0.5. Its decimal value is 6651952.

Shades and Tints of #658030
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0b0e05 is the darkest color, while #ffffff is the lightest one.
